Perbandingan Kaedah Pendaftaran Acara: jQuery.click() vs onClick
Dalam aplikasi jQuery, terdapat dua kaedah biasa digunakan untuk mengendalikan klik peristiwa: .click() jQuery dan atribut HTML onClick. Artikel ini akan menyelidiki kelebihan dan keburukan relatifnya.
jQuery.click()
Kaedah ini melibatkan penggunaan jQuery untuk mengikat pendengar acara klik pada elemen. Ia menggunakan pendaftaran acara moden melalui addEventListener.
Kelebihan:
onClick Atribut
Kaedah ini ialah atribut HTML yang menetapkan fungsi JavaScript untuk dilaksanakan apabila elemen diklik.
Kelemahan:
Pertimbangan Prestasi dan Standard
Dari segi prestasi, .click() jQuery secara amnya lebih disukai kerana ia memanfaatkan mekanisme pengendalian acara yang dioptimumkan oleh moden pelayar.
Mengenai standard, .click() mematuhi DOM W3C spesifikasi pendaftaran acara, manakala onClick ialah kaedah lapuk yang mungkin tidak disokong dalam penyemak imbas masa hadapan.
Kesimpulan
Secara keseluruhannya, .click() jQuery ialah kaedah yang disyorkan untuk mengendalikan acara klik dalam pembangunan web moden. Ia menawarkan pematuhan standard, fleksibiliti dan faedah prestasi. Atribut onClick, walaupun masih boleh digunakan dalam kod lama, sebaiknya dielakkan untuk aplikasi baharu.
Atas ialah kandungan terperinci jQuery .click() vs. onClick: Kaedah Pendaftaran Acara Mana Yang Perlu Anda Pilih?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!